## RateLens Environment Variables

RateLens is Brindlewick Hospitality's rate-parity checker. It polls partner booking feeds every fifteen minutes and flags hotels whose published rates drift from the contracted baseline.

Most configuration lives in `rate-lens.env`. Set `RL_REGION` to your assigned market, `RL_POLL_INTERVAL` to 900 unless told otherwise, and `RL_LOG_LEVEL` to `info` for normal runs.

The feed aggregator also requires an API credential to authenticate outbound requests. Add the following line to the file:

env line for fafof-fahag: LEDGER_TOKEN5=f8790

- [ ] Weather-alert fan-out key ceremony, step 4: Verify that the Stormline fan-out service's signing key has been rotated and that the old key is revoked in the Harrowgate registry. Confirm two witnesses initialed the rotation log. Before sealing the backup shard, the reviewer must confirm the recovery passphrase matches the ceremony record; it is recorded immediately below.

recovery phrase for bawep-kawef: oliath-casdor

## Onboarding: Role-Based Access in the Fernhall Wiki

Fernhall assigns three roles: reader, editor, and steward. Stewards alone may alter access-control pages, and every change is logged to an immutable audit stream. For your review, the steward break-account exists solely for emergencies and is sealed by a passphrase, which is recorded below.

strongbox words: zorwyn-sorael-belion-ulaius-silmir-ulays-briax-rusdor-gorix